1997 Dodge 5.2 poptop value

I need a little help pricing my camper van.I bought a full Class b motor home due to my wife's arthritis.It saddens me because I love my van but love wife more.It is a 97 Dodge 5.2 with 125,000 miles.Thetford Curve,hand pump for dishes with 6 gallon fresh and grey below.Custom cabinets are really nice and hold a lot of stuff.When I transferred everything to the new van it nearly filled the bigger vans cabinets.It has Nexen AT's that I really like and runs great.Very clean inside with no tears in upholstery or penthouse.Ice cold air but a vacuum leak causes it to jump to defrost under heavy load (should I fix before posting?).I'm thinking around $7,000 to $7,500.I won't be offended by comments so be honest.

Basically your value is in the van body and the PH, so I'd look at the book value for the van, add in a percentage of what the PH would cost to add, and have that be your number. Your van itself looks very nice. Unfortunately it seems that Dodge vans usually go for less than the comparable Ford SMBs, just because the platform is not as common and doesn't have as many aftermarket accessories, etc., available for it.

The average home build interior only adds significant value if it's really well done and basically in line with what a stock SMB (or other RV) interior would be like. In some cases, it might actually diminish the value of the van. Yours looks functional but not much more than that (at least from the photos), and unless you get the exact perfect buyer, they will likely be thinking about tearing it out or significantly redoing it IMO.

I would clean up the interior a good bit, perhaps enclose those wires and the area where the PortaPotty is, restain/varnish your sink countertop, etc.

^To expand on that.... A Dodge van with 125,000 will have barely any value at all. Maybe a couple thousand at best. Basically, price it for the Penthouse and interior. It'll be subjective, but maybe you'll get lucky and find a Dodge lover.
